Antonio's struggle with Zoe's communication style and energy highlighted a crucial realization: changing an individual's behavior can be exhausting for both leaders and teams, often forcing tough decisions.
Experts emphasize that once a decision to terminate is made, swift action is necessary to alleviate team stress and move forward. However, organizations must gauge the potential impact on operations.
Firing an underperformer might relieve immediate team burdens, yet it can also lead to business gaps and impact client relations, necessitating a careful balance in decision-making.
The decision to terminate is further complicated by fears of bias and the potential negative effects on team dynamics, illustrating the intricate nature of leadership choices in challenging situations.
